Transaction 8e5a146a38a92efaac159f9ab069d4822c175976bb7dbb5de8032a2b1f319543
1 Input
1 Output
-
8e5a146a38a92efaac159f9ab069d4822c175976bb7dbb5de8032a2b1f319543:0
- value
- 866952150
- script pubkey
- OP_0 OP_PUSHBYTES_20 61e8430b5b3f4012c8921ded58aab9410116a740
- address
- bc1qv85yxz6m8aqp9jyjrhk4324egyq3df6q8sk8cd